> I once saw “half = num >> 1” instead of, say, “half = floor(num / 2)”.
Again, that's just stuff that's getting you a small constant factor less code, a few characters here and there. To get closer to an order of magnitude smaller program solving the same problem requires a deeper understanding of the problem and different strategies for solving it.
To me, the gold standard example for the 10x to 100x coder is always Peter Norvig.
https://norvig.com/spell-correct.html https://norvig.com/sudoku.html
Notice the clear comments and detailed explanations and reasonable identifier names. But do you think the median developer would solve these problems with a similar amount of actual code?

I agree with the fact that a team of "good" developers will outperform a team of The issue is, whiteboarding people on trivia programming problems doesn't determine if they are a 10x/good developer - it only determines if they understand the particular trivia they are asked.
If they can, the next part is fit. You need to get over both bars to be hired.
All of this is incredibly noisy, so part of what happens is you have to set the bar high, since 37% of the people you interview will perform one std. div. above where they actually are, and 5% will perform 2 std. div. above where they actually are. Setting a high bar means you lose a lot of good people due to random error. But the costs of one bad hire are EXTREME compared to missing a few good hires. So it makes sense to do that.
People take rejections personally, but in most interview processes, it's pretty random. You have a bar. You hire people who interview 1-2 std. div. above that bar. You might be perfectly qualified, and I won't hire you if you had a bad day (or even an average day). The risk is too high. If you're 1 std. div. above, I'm moderately confident you're qualified. If you're 2 std. div. above, I'm very confident. And having hired people, that's how it plays out: I mostly hire people who interviewed well, and their performance on a typical day is typically lower than at the interview (not always, but usually).
Hiring is about finding and bringing in good people as efficiently as possible. I'd rather interview 20 people, hire two I'm confident are good (miss six qualified people among those 20 who had bad days), than I would bring in 10 people and hire two of them.
And bad people still slip in. You just can't do that much in an 8 hour interview.
For startups, I go for personal recs and github repos. Does that mean I miss people who aren't in my network, and who don't do open source? Of course. But that's okay. I still find enough really good people that way. (And yes, my network IS diverse, thank you very much).
But big companies need standardized processes, or things get rife with discrimination, nepotism, and all sorts of other nastiness. That easy to avoid small-scale, but with 1000 employees, it takes one bad apple to land on front page NY Times.
